曾经有一位名叫杰克的年轻人,对编程充满了热情和好奇心。他一直坚信着代码的魔力,这让他拥有了无限的创造力和想象力。
梦中的函数
杰克痴迷于编写自己的类和函数,他希望通过代码创造出令人惊叹的效果。有一天,他遇到了一个问题,他想要在自定义类函数中返回一个具体的值。
困惑的迷宫
杰克进入了像迷宫一样复杂的思考过程。他试了很多方法,但总是遇到了问题。他苦苦思索着,这就像是在一个迷宫中,找不到出口。
终于悟道
就在他几乎放弃的那一刻,他突然明白了一种解决方案。他想到了使用return
语句来返回自定义类函数的值。
珠玉在前
杰克决定将他的新发现,与大家分享。他创建了一个名为MyClass
的自定义类,并在其中编写了一个函数my_function
,他引用了该类的一个属性,并使用return
语句返回了这个属性。
class MyClass:
def __init__(self, value):
self.value = value
def my_function(self):
return self.value
代码的奇妙旅程
通过杰克的示例代码,我们可以看出这段代码是如此简单而又精妙。首先,他定义了一个名为MyClass
的类,这个类有一个构造函数__init__
,它接收一个参数value
并将其存储在类的属性self.value
中。
接下来是函数my_function
,这个函数非常简洁明了。它只有一行代码,使用return
语句返回了self.value
。这样,当调用my_function
时,它将会返回MyClass
类的实例所包含的值。
成果与思考
杰克成功地解决了他的问题,并汇总了他的学习经验。他意识到在自定义类函数中使用return
语句,可以轻松地从函数中获取具体的结果。他感到非常欣慰和满足,因为他的代码之旅又取得了一个重要的里程碑。
通过这个故事,我们可以看到编程世界中的一片辽阔和无限可能。像杰克一样,我们应该坚持不懈地追求知识,不断探索和创造。让代码成为我们思维的延伸,用它开启未知世界的大门。
神龙|纯净稳定代理IP免费测试>>>>>>>>天启|企业级代理IP免费测试>>>>>>>>IPIPGO|全球住宅代理IP免费测试